Understanding Operational Excellence
Operational excellence is a management philosophy that focuses on improving the efficiency and effectiveness of an organization's operations to achieve superior performance. It encompasses various principles, practices, and tools that enable businesses to minimize waste, reduce costs, and enhance customer satisfaction. At its core, operational excellence is about continuously improving processes, eliminating non-value-added activities, and delivering consistent value to customers.

Implementing Continuous Improvement Practices
Continuous improvement is the foundation of operational excellence. Organizations should establish mechanisms for gathering feedback, analyzing data, and implementing improvements on an ongoing basis. This can involve practices such as lean management, Six Sigma, Kaizen, and quality circles. By fostering a culture of continuous improvement, organizations can drive innovation, enhance efficiency, and sustain operational excellence over the long term.
Lean management principles can eliminate waste and streamline processes, resulting in improved productivity and reduced costs.
Six Sigma methodologies can help organizations identify and eliminate defects, leading to higher quality products or services.
Kaizen, a Japanese term meaning "change for the better," emphasizes small, incremental improvements that add up over time.
Quality circles are small groups of employees who meet regularly to identify and solve work-related problems.
The Role of Technology in Operational Excellence
Technology plays a pivotal role in driving operational excellence. By embracing technology solutions, organizations can automate processes, analyze data, and gain insights that enable informed decision-making.
Automation and Operational Excellence
Automation eliminates manual, repetitive tasks, freeing up resources and reducing errors. By automating processes, organizations can improve efficiency, enhance accuracy, and minimize waste. Automation also enables organizations to scale operations, accommodate growth, and respond quickly to market demands.
In the manufacturing industry, technology has revolutionized the production line. Automated machines can now perform tasks that were previously done manually, such as assembling components or packaging products. This not only speeds up the production process but also reduces the risk of human error.
However, automation extends beyond the manufacturing floor. In the service industry, businesses can use technology to automate customer service processes, such as chatbots that can handle customer inquiries and provide instant responses. This not only improves customer satisfaction but also allows employees to focus on more complex tasks that require human intervention.
Data Analytics for Performance Measurement
Data analytics provides organizations with valuable insights into their operations. By analyzing data, you can identify patterns, uncover trends, and make data-driven decisions to optimize performance.
In the retail industry, technology has enabled organizations to collect vast amounts of customer data. By analyzing this data, retailers can gain insights into customer preferences, buying patterns, and even predict future trends. This information can then be used to tailor marketing strategies, optimize inventory management, and improve overall business performance.
In the healthcare sector, data analytics plays a crucial role in improving patient outcomes. By analyzing patient data, healthcare providers can identify patterns that may indicate potential health risks or predict disease progression. This allows for early intervention and personalized treatment plans, ultimately leading to better patient care and improved health outcomes.
Moreover, data analytics can also help organizations identify areas for process improvement. By analyzing operational data, organizations can identify bottlenecks, inefficiencies, and areas of waste. This information can then be used to streamline processes, reduce costs, and improve overall operational efficiency.
Overcoming Challenges in Implementing Operational Excellence
Implementing an operational excellence strategy is not without challenges. Organizations should be prepared to address and overcome these challenges to ensure the success of their initiatives. Two common challenges include:
Resistance to Change: Employees may feel uncomfortable or skeptical about new processes, technologies, or ways of working. To overcome this resistance, communicate the benefits of operational excellence, involve employees in the change process, provide training and support, and recognize and reward contributions. By addressing concerns and involving employees from the start, organizations can foster buy-in and facilitate a smooth transition.
Ensuring Consistency and Sustainability: Operational excellence is not a one-time project; it requires ongoing commitment and effort. Organizations must ensure consistency and sustainability by embedding operational excellence principles into their culture, processes, and performance management systems. Regular communication, monitoring progress, and celebrating successes can help reinforce the importance of operational excellence and maintain momentum.

The difference between Scrum master and project manager
Before we dive into the differences between the two, let’s first define Scrum and project management.
Defining Scrum
Scrum is an Agile project management methodology that enables teams to deliver high-quality products and involves regular reviews and feedback sessions. It is repetitive and focuses on delivering features in short sprints. Scrum teams typically consist of a Scrum master, product owner, and development team members.
Defining project management
On the other hand, traditional project management is a methodology that is more linear in nature. It aims to plan, control, and execute a project successfully, step by step. This involves defining goals, analyzing resources, developing timelines, and monitoring progress. Project managers are responsible for overseeing the project’s delivery and ensuring it meets the objectives.
Roles and responsibilities of a Scrum master
The Scrum master is a critical role in any Agile development team. They make sure the team follows the Scrum methodology and delivers high-quality work on time and within budget. Essentially, the Scrum master is a servant leader who collaborates with the development team. They also work with the product owner and other stakeholders to ensure that everyone is aligned and working toward achieving the project’s objectives.
Facilitate Scrum events
The Scrum master arranges and leads Scrum activities like sprint planning, daily standups, sprint reviews, and sprint retrospectives. During these events, the Scrum master ensures that the team stays focused and on track. Any issues or challenges that may be hindering progress are identified and addressed to boost the team’s overall productivity.
Sprint planning requires collaborating with the product owner and development team to create a sprint backlog that outlines the work to be completed during the sprint. Scrum masters clarify the sprint goals for the team, so that everybody knows what must be accomplished.
Daily standups involve ensuring that everyone on the team is following the Scrum framework and is aware of each teammate’s progress. Scrum masters identify any roadblocks and work with the team to remove them.
Sprint reviews require communication with the team to review all completed tasks during the sprint. The work must meet the definition of ‘Completed,’ so that the Scrum master can assist the product owner in updating the product backlog based on the team’s progress.
Lastly, sprint retrospectives involve identifying areas for improvement and assisting the team in developing a subsequent action plan. Scrum masters also ensure that the team is continuously learning and improving.

Coach the team
The Scrum master is responsible for coaching the development team on Scrum principles and practices. The team must understand and follow the Scrum framework and continuously improve their processes and practices.
Areas for improvement are identified and addressed by the Scrum master alongside the team. They provide guidance and support to ensure that everyone is aligned and working toward achieving the project’s objectives.
Remove roadblocks
The Scrum master finds and removes obstacles that stop the team from delivering good features. They collaborate with the development team, product owner, and others to ensure the team has what it needs for success.
Teams are aided by the Scrum master to identify and address any issues or challenges that may be hindering progress. They work with the team to remove roadblocks that slow down productivity.
Ensure transparency and collaboration
The Scrum master is responsible for fostering transparency and collaboration within the team and between the team and stakeholders. They ensure that everyone is aware of the project’s progress and that the team is working toward achieving its objectives.
They also work with the product owner to ensure that the product backlog is transparent and that everyone understands the priorities and goals of the project.
Roles and responsibilities of a project manager
The project manager, in contrast to the Scrum master, oversees the entire project life cycle and works closely with stakeholders. Their key responsibilities include:
Define project scope and objectives
Defining the project scope means identifying the boundaries of the project and determining what is included and excluded. This step is important to make sure the project stays on track and the team members know what they have to do.
Outlining the objectives requires identifying the specific outcomes that the project is expected to achieve. This ensures the project matches the organization’s goals and that everyone is working toward the same outcome.
Identifying the resources required to deliver the project involves determining what people, equipment, and materials are needed. This makes sure the project has enough resources and avoids delays or bottlenecks caused by a lack of resources.
Develop a project plan
Developing a comprehensive project plan involves breaking down the project into smaller, more manageable tasks. This allows the team to keep track of tasks and deadlines. Creating timelines ensures that the project is completed on time and maintains a sense of organization.
Identify and manage risks and issues
This means anticipating potential problems that may arise during the project and developing strategies to address them. Doing this makes sure the project isn’t affected by surprises and the team is ready to deal with any problems.
The project manager must also work with stakeholders to address these and ensure that the project remains on track. This means tracking the team’s progress against the project plan and crafting solutions. This could include adjusting the project plan or allocating additional resources to address the issue.
Ensure quality
Project managers must confirm that their team’s work meets project requirements and the tasks’ criteria. Additionally, they need to make sure that it follows relevant standards or regulations. This may involve developing quality standards and processes, conducting quality reviews, and providing feedback to the team.
Comparing the skill sets of Scrum masters and project managers
Although both roles focus on delivering projects, they require different skill sets. Some of the key differences include:
Leadership styles
Scrum masters typically follow a servant-leadership style, where they lead by example, empower the team, and prioritize the team’s needs. They believe in serving the team members rather than managing them. They act as a coach, mentor, and facilitator, allowing the team to self-organize and make its own decisions. Scrum masters also encourage collaboration, continuous improvement, and innovation.
Project managers lead and make decisions for the team, using an authoritative leadership style. They are responsible for ensuring that the project is completed within the desired budget, scope, and timeline. Project managers have the power to give tasks, distribute resources, and make important choices. They also check task progress and update stakeholders.
Communication skills
Scrum masters need good communication skills to help teams work together and be open. They talk to team members, stakeholders, and customers every day. They also need to be good listeners, effectively understanding the needs and concerns of the team and addressing them promptly.
Although project managers also need strong communication skills, they often focus more on communicating project progress to stakeholders and addressing all of their concerns. Therefore, project managers must be good negotiators, effectively resolving conflicts and reaching agreements.
Problem solving abilities
Scrum masters need to be skilled problem solvers, as they often address issues that arise during the development process. They must be able to identify the root cause of the problem, propose solutions, and implement them. They also encourage the team to come up with creative solutions and experiment with new ideas.
As for project managers, they also need to have strong problem solving skills. However, they tend to focus more on risk management and identifying risks. They must be able to anticipate potential problems and develop contingency plans. They must evaluate the risks’ effect on the project and take suitable steps to reduce them.
Adaptability and flexibility
Scrum masters need to be adaptable and flexible to pivot their approach and adapt to changes as the project progresses. They must be able to embrace change and encourage the team to do the same. They also need to be able to adjust the scope, timeline, and budget of the project to accommodate changes.
Project managers must do the same, even though they tend to develop and follow a more rigid plan. They must be able to adjust the plan as needed while ensuring that the project stays within the scope, timeline, and budget. Project managers also must balance the needs of the stakeholders with the needs of the team.
